The word "smiths" is commonly found in U.S. public school names primarily due to its significance in American history and culture. The term "smith" originally refers to skilled metalworkers, such as blacksmiths or silversmiths, who played vital roles in early American communities by providing essential tools and services. Many towns and regions across the United States bear the name "Smith" or "Smiths," either after prominent families, individuals, or as a nod to the profession itself, which further influences school naming. Additionally, "Smith" is a common surname in the United States, and some schools are named in honor of local leaders, educators, or benefactors who carried this name, reflecting their contributions to the community and education. Thus, the frequent appearance of "smiths" in school names is rooted in both historical occupations and the recognition of influential people or places in American society.
